If you have songs created on a VS-880 or VS-880EX
that you would like to edit on the VS-1680, you will
need to convert them to the VS-1680s format using the
Song Import function. If your VS-880 or VS-880EX
backup is not in a playable form (e.g. DAT, CD-R, or on
a Zip disk in archive format), you will need to recover
that material on to a VS-1680 formatted drive first. Use
the following procedure to recover a VS-880 or
VS-880EX DAT backup:
1) Connect the digital output of your DAT machine to
the VS-1680s digital input (DIGIN1 for coaxial or
DIGIN 2 for optical).
2) Load the DAT tape that contains the desired song
and set the tape to playback from the beginning of
that song backup.
3) Hold SHIFT and press F6 [Utility] to display the
Utility Menu.
4) Press PAGE so that DATRc appears above F1 (if
necessary). Press F1 [DATRc] to display the DAT
Recover screen.
5) Use the CURSOR buttons and TIME/VALUE dial to
select the appropriate Digital In Source (DIGIN 1
for coaxial or DIGIN 2 for optical).
6) Use the CURSOR buttons and TIME/VALUE dial to
select the song to be recovered under Source Song.
